Output 7bc425d146d36c532a943ac6443592530974d8de3368dc269a7003f0c836230a:1

value
29026034
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88962521c77764c15f8015c32c8e2d46153b76cb OP_EQUALVERIFY OP_CHECKSIG
address
1DTCmMHHqubbDDKv1m4io4Ay1H6GtkfVfZ
transaction
7bc425d146d36c532a943ac6443592530974d8de3368dc269a7003f0c836230a
spent
true